вывод звука на андроид
899 UAHВ общем есть некая страница- программа. Клиент связи с водителями такси, через браузер.
При появление нового заказа на планшете должна проиграться мелодия.
сейчас это происходит при помощи браузера фаерфокс
и файла js.
Но к сожалению данные звук работает не на всех планшетах, хотя все они под управлением андроид 4 и выше.
Хотелось бы чтоб звук воспроизводился не в виде какого-то отдельного файла а посредством стандартных системных звуков. Например пиликала как будто смс-ка пришла. Естественно при рабочем браузере где страница обновляется с переодичностью 30 сек.
текст js файла
var myWin;
var hitSound = new Audio('zvon.mp3');
function play() {
var MSIE=navigator.userAgent.indexOf("MSIE");
var OPER=navigator.userAgent.indexOf("Opera")
var FFOX=navigator.userAgent.indexOf("Firefox");
var CHROM=navigator.userAgent.indexOf("Chrome");
var SAFAR=navigator.userAgent.indexOf("Safari");
var MSAFAR=navigator.userAgent.indexOf("MobileSafari");
// alert( navigator.userAgent);
// alert( 'IE=' + MSIE +'/n' + 'OPER='+OPER +'/n' + 'FFOX='+FFOX+'/n' + 'CHROM='+CHROM+'/n' + 'SAFAR='+SAFAR+'/n' + 'MSAFAR='+MSAFAR );
if (SAFAR>-1) {
hitSound.play();
}
if (MSIE>-1) {
myWin = open( 'zvon.mp3' );
setTimeout( "myWin.close()", 9000 );
}
if ( (OPER>-1) || (FFOX>-1) || (CHROM>=1) ) {
var hitSound = new Audio('nazn.mp3');
hitSound.play();
}
}
function play2() {
var MSIE=navigator.userAgent.indexOf("MSIE");
var OPER=navigator.userAgent.indexOf("Opera")
var FFOX=navigator.userAgent.indexOf("Firefox");
var CHROM=navigator.userAgent.indexOf("Chrome");
var SAFAR=navigator.userAgent.indexOf("Safari");
var MSAFAR=navigator.userAgent.indexOf("MobileSafari");
if (SAFAR>-1) {
var hitSound = new Audio('nazn.mp3');
hitSound.play();
}
if (MSIE>-1) {
var hitSound = new Audio('nazn.mp3');
hitSound.play();
}
if ( (OPER>-1) || (FFOX>-1) || (CHROM>=1) ) {
var hitSound = new Audio('nazn.mp3');
hitSound.play();
}
}
Відгук замовника про співпрацю з Ivan Zakharchuk
вывод звука на андроидСпасибо за качественно выполненную работу.
За данный проект взялся только этот фрилансер. Всё было выполнено учитывая все мои пожелания, со знанием дела. Также ввиду того что банковская система в Крыму временно не работает, с оплатой также пошли мне на встречу и дали возможность оплатить единственным возможным способом.
![]()
Відгук фрилансера про співпрацю з замовником
вывод звука на андроидЗаказчик хорошо сформулировал задание. По ходу дела, четко следовал моим инструкциям для решения задачи.
-
Переможець2 дні899 UAH
153 5 0 Переможець2 дні899 UAHЗдраствуйте!
Готов помочь. Пишите: [email protected]
П.С, Единственный вариант это корректно использовать HTML5 аудиоелемент, т.к. "родные" звуки Android возможно воспроизводить только посредством нативных java приложений, т.е. это другая область задач.
Актуальні фриланс-проєкти в категорії Javascript та Typescript
Розробка платформи AM Mobility (автосервіс, парковка, страхування, оренда автомобілів)
259 176 UAH
Шукаємо команду або досвідченого Full Stack розробника для створення MVP платформи AM Mobility. AM Mobility — це єдина цифрова екосистема для автомобілістів, що об'єднує в одному додатку та веб-платформі: парковку; автосервіс; шиномонтаж; автомийку; оренду автомобілів;… Javascript та Typescript, Веб-програмування ∙ 5 днів 6 годин тому ∙ 114 ставок |
Gsap анімації
1000 UAH
Доброго дня. Треба внести правки в поточному проєкті. Потрібен фахівець, який добре працює на gsap/lenis Треба зробити анімацію карточок. Детально ТЗ тут: https://www.figma.com/design/5bLEJudN5LPpB9ZSoJa2Eb/Untitled?m=auto&t=qwyluUctL1lrMNvh-6 Треба проявити креатив та… Javascript та Typescript, Веб-програмування ∙ 5 днів 11 годин тому ∙ 21 ставка |
Шукаю наставника з Claude Code для запуску веб-проєкту з нуля**Коротко про завдання:** Я новачок без досвіду в програмуванні. Є готове ТЗ на розробку сайту (42 сторінки, Next.js, PostgreSQL). Хочу реалізувати його самостійно за допомогою Claude Code - потрібен спеціаліст, який налаштує середовище і навчить мене працювати з інструментом.… Javascript та Typescript, Навчання ∙ 7 днів 10 годин тому ∙ 19 ставок |
Оновлення дизайну на сайтіПотрібно оновити дизайн існуючого сайту, використовуючи HTML, CSS, JS: освіжити зовнішній вигляд, зробити його сучасним і адаптивним під мобільні пристрої. Потрібно додати плавні анімації та інтерактивні елементи. HTML та CSS верстання, Javascript та Typescript ∙ 8 днів 4 години тому ∙ 97 ставок |
Консультація та аудит поточного проєкту на Odoo 19 Community EditionШукаємо Odoo Developer — соло-розробника з досвідом розробки на Odoo 19 Community Edition, у тому числі за допомогою Claude Code. Нам потрібен спеціаліст, який має успішно реалізовані проєкти в Odoo та практичний досвід розробки з використанням Claude Code. Важливо: розглядаємо… C та C++, Javascript та Typescript ∙ 8 днів 10 годин тому ∙ 8 ставок |